Description
This is an interview position. To assist management in overseeing daily sort, delivery/pickup activities and remote domicile location/feeder Ops (where applicable).
Leads the sector as assigned ensuring best practices and effective operations and models the way for hourly employees by becoming a mentor and demonstrating role model behaviour including strong communication, conflict resolution and leadership ability through Best Practices methods.
Required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ities Educational Requirements
High school diploma/equivalent
Related Experience Requirements
Minimum one (1) year current Courier experience
Technical Skill Requirements
Must possess a valid drivers licence and have a good driving record
Ability to successfully complete all basic and recurrency training (including DG specialist certification) and maintain accreditation through yearly recurrency training prior to expiration
Remains current with training in BP and defensive driver/process updates
Good understanding of FedEx products, features of service, general operations
Ability to lift 70 lbs and maneuver any package weighing up to 150 lbs with appropriate equipment
Some knowledge of Federal Express operations and Canadian Customs regulations is an asset
Solid communications/interpersonal skills with the ability to motivate/coach and train employees on the job
Ability to prioritize and delegate in a time-sensitive manner
Interpersonal Skill Requirements
Demonstrated excellent interpersonal, customer relations, and communication skills
Good analytical, problem solving, prioritization, and organization skills
Team player

In addition to the usual factors used in the selection process, all candidates for positions that require driving as a core competency require a valid driver's license (e.g. Class 5,G, or 1[AZ]) and a driving record with two or fewer violations and/or accidents in the 24 months prior to the date of application. Further, candidates will be assessed through careful consideration of: 1) their current driver's abstract; 2) their performance during application interviews; and 3) their performance on any driver competency assessments administered.
